As Bastille Day draws near, live with accessories that say "Vive la France."

Wing it

Baccarat predates the storming of the Bastille by a quarter-century, but its lead-crystal Papillon Lucky Butterfly ($112.50) is a newer design. Available at Lisa M. Reisman & Cie., 1714 Rittenhouse Square, and www.lisart.com.

Pretty in Paris

A set of Parisian-themed Tumbled Marble Coasters ($44) with cork undersides will flaunt your Francophilia. Available at Host Interiors, 205 Arch St. and 8236 Germantown Ave.

L'art de vivre

Esteemed French maker Garnier-Thiebaut goes modern with this Crepuscule or "Twilight" design (jacquard-weave tablecloths start at $180), featuring silhouettes from the garden. Available at Kellijane, 1721 Spruce St.

Bon voyage

The Par Avion Bag Tag ($17) lends luggage a certain je ne sais quoi. Available at www.flight001.com.

Monkey around

Juliska's Petit Singe, or "Little Monkey," dinnerware ($129 for a five-piece place setting), is whitewashed for an antiqued, French country look. Available at Manor Home & Gifts, 210 S. 17th St., and www.manorhg.com.

Bistro chic

Modeled after 19th-century bistro chairs, these colorful outdoor perches ($98) fit small city yards. Available at Terrain at Styer's, 914 Baltimore Pike, Glen Mills.

La vie bohème

Duralex's tempered-glass Picardie tumblers ($3) are a Gallic essential at a recession-friendly price. Available at Foster's Homeware, 399 Market St., and www.shopfosters.com.
